Research Facilities
  • Department Facilities:
    In addition to the modern research laboratories managed by our faculty, the Department of Biochemistry operates laboratories for instruction and common research facilites. Instruments available to members of the Department include ultra- and preparative centrifuges, liquid scintillation counters, FPLC's, a gel imaging system, a Phosphorimager, UV/visible spectrophotometers, circular dichroism spectropolarimeter, spectrofluorimeters, gas chromatographs, several PCR thermocylers, molecular graphics workstations, a cell culture lab, incubators, controlled-temperature rooms, and dark rooms.

  • Additional Shared Facilities:

Campus Chemical Instrument Center that has the latest research facilities in Nuclear Magnetic Resonance (NMR) and Mass Spectrometry (MS).

Campus Microscopy and Imaging Facility

Provides services for Confocal, Electron and Light Microscopy
 

The Molecular Biology Store

Provides a convenient source for common reagents, enzymes, and kits used in molecular biology and recombinant DNA research.
 

Center for Molecular Neurobiology

Provides transgenic animal and ES cell services
 

OSU College of Biological Sciences Greenhouses
 

OSU Fermentation Facility

A service laboratory that provides fermentation services on a nominal fee-for-service basis.


Ohio Supercomputer Center

A state facility that provides consultation, workshops, and software services


Plant-Microbe Genomics Facility

Provides DNA sequencing, Genotyping, DNA Microarray, Quantitative PCR, Proteomics, Robotics, and Microplate Reading Services
